ARCB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

150 of the 4,539 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ArcBest (ARCB)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$392M — down 38% from $630M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 24 funds closed out of ARCB and 19 opened new positions — a net loss of 5 holders — while 53 trimmed existing stakes and 56 added.

The largest buyer was Scopus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$10.1M. The largest seller was Vanguard Group, cutting an estimated $10.7M.
